Kenyan International Eric Ouma Marcello bagged as assist to help his Swedish Division one side Vasalunds win 2-1 on a league match played on Sunday.
The team was away at Sylvia FC and fell behind in the 4th minute. However Eric Ouma’ssuperb drive and cross from the center circle saw Cedric Danha sweep the ball home for the equalizer just two minutes later. Ekin Bullut sealed the comeback win for Vasalunds in the 64th minute with Marcelo playing the full ninety minutes.

The win leaves Vasalunds 7th on the table with 40 points from 26 matches. Marcelo has cemented his position at the club as the starting left-back following a string of impressive performances.
Only last month, he scored his first goal this season, a right-footed shot into the bottom corner.

Ouma has been called up for the Harambee Stars team that will play Mozambique in a friendly match set to be staged at the Moi International Sports Center Kasarani on Sunday, October 13.
Francis Kimanzi’s team has however been dealt a blow with the news that Algerianbased striker Masud Juma will miss the clash with an ankle injury. He has since been replaced by Ulinzi Stars striker Enosh Ochieng.
The match will be in preparation for the Africa Cup Of Nations qualifier match away to Mohamed Salah’s Egypt in November.
